BITSAT 2026 photo and signature guidelines specify the requirements to fill the BITSAT application form 2026. Candidates cannot submit the BITSAT application form if the photo and signature guidelines are not met. Check this article for the photo and signature guidelines for BITSAT 2026, including format, size, background rules, dos and don’ts, and common mistakes to avoid.
BITSAT 2026 Photo and Signature Guidelines: BITS Pilani is conducting the BITSAT 2026 registration for session 1 at admissions.bits-pilani.ac.in. The BITSAT 2026 registration last date for session 1 was March 16, 2026. To apply for BITSAT 2026, candidates have to complete registration, form-filling, uploading of documents and fee payment. Applicants must refer to the BITSAT photo and signature guidelines to avoid rejection of the application form.
Uploading incorrect images is one of the most common reasons for application rejection or problems during verification. The online BITSAT application form is designed in a way that rejects any document that fails to meet the prescribed guidelines. Importance of BITSAT 2026 Photo and Signature Guidelines
Any mismatch or unclear image will lead to the disqualification of the application form, even if the form is completed correctly. Thus, candidates must adhere to the photo and signature guidelines and ensure a smooth application process. The photograph and signature uploaded during BITSAT registration are used at multiple stages of the admission process, such as:
- Application verification.
- Admit card generation.
- Verification at the exam centre.
- Counselling and admission formalities.

BITSAT 2026 Photograph Guidelines
Candidates must upload a recent passport-size photograph while filling the BITSAT 2026 application form. The photograph should be clear, natural, and identifiable. Check the following table to know the permissible file size and dimensions for BITSAT registration.
BITSAT Photo Size Guidelines 2026
| Partculars | Details |
|---|---|
| Dimensions | 3.5 cm X 4.5 cm |
| File Size | 50 - 100KB |
| Format | .jpg/.jpeg |
Instructions for Photograph Upload
Check the important instructions for BITSAT photograph upload below.
- Students have to upload a recent photograph.
- It should be clear and unedited.
- The image background should be plain and light-coloured.
BITSAT 2026 Signature Guidelines
Along with the photograph, candidates must upload a scanned image of their signature. The authority has also specified its guidelines as mentioned in the table below.
BITSAT Signature Size Guidelines 2026
| Partculars | Details |
|---|---|
| Dimensions | - |
| File Size | 10 KB to 100 KB |
| Format | .jpg/.jpeg |
BITSAT Signature Instructions
- Sign on plain white paper using a black or blue ink pen.
- The signature should be done by the candidate only.
- Avoid capital letters.
- The signature must be clear and not smudged.

BITS, Pilani, conducts the BITSAT exam in two shifts. The timings for the morning session are from 9 AM to 12 PM, and others are from 2 PM to 5 PM in the afternoon session. Candidates can select the BITSAT slot timings using the BITSAT slot booking system.

How to Scan and Upload BITSAT Photo and Signature Correctly?
Candidates can check below how to upload the photo and signature files in the BITSAT registration form.
- Use a smartphone camera in good lighting.
- Place the photograph or signature on a flat surface.
- Ensure there are no shadows or reflections.
- Crop the image neatly.
- Adjust the file size using basic image editing tools if required.
Common Errors to Avoid While Uploading Images
Below, we have listed a few common errors to avoid while filling the BITSAT 2026 application form in relation to the uploading stage. These mistakes cost students an attempt; students have to be mindful of these. Candidates must double-check the uploaded images before submitting.
- Uploading blurred photographs.
- Avoid selfies or casual photos.
- Uploading signatures with dark backgrounds.
- Incorrect file format.
- Uploading someone else’s signature or photograph.
What Happens If the Photo or Signature Is Incorrect?
If the uploaded photograph or signature does not meet the guidelines:
- The application may be marked as incomplete.
- Candidates will not be given the BITSAT admit card.
- Correction facility were available from March 18 to 20, 2026.
